WASHINGTON, DC-Canadian commercial real estate company Avison Young has opened an office in the District that it hopes to develop into a full service commercial real estate brokerage. Keith Lipton, former executive vice president and managing director of Grubb & Ellis’ local office, has been recruited as managing director of the Avison Young operation. Also joining from Grubb & Ellis are Margaret Donkerbrook, as vice president of Research and Sarah Peyton, as regional operations manager.

Lipton tells GlobeSt.com that the company intends to open offices in Maryland and Virginia; the timetable depending on the company’s acquisition and recruiting activities. It intends to build out staff–at least 20 brokers by the end of 2010–through hires and acquisition of local firms. He declined to provide additional details about the company’s growth plans or go-to-market strategy other than to say the company expects to have closed its first deal by end of Q1 2010.

The DC office is part of Avison Young’s larger strategy of building out a network of offices in the US, following its year-long national consolidation in Canada, a process that also included the acquisition of Darton Property Advisors and Managers. In January 2009, the company opened its first US office, in Chicago.

A number of brokerage firms have set up shop or expanded operations in the District recently, including FirstService REA, which brought on board much of the former GVA Advantis team. Other examples include Cassidy & Pinkard Colliers which is building out a tenant rep division.
